  1. Your Garage Door Makes Loud or Uncommon Noises

Garage doors naturally make some sound when they run, but sudden or abnormally loud sounds must not be disregarded. If your door has actually ended up being visibly louder than typical, there may be a concern with one or more of its moving elements.



Grinding, shrieking, popping, banging, rattling and persistent squeaking can all show potential problems. Grinding might be associated with worn rollers or issues with the tracks, while a loud popping noise can sometimes suggest an issue with a garage door spring.

Sometimes, a squeaky garage door might merely need appropriate lubrication. If lubrication does not fix the noise or the noise keeps returning, there may be underlying wear that needs expert attention.

It is essential not to take apart or adjust springs and cables yourself. These elements can be under substantial stress and incorrect handling can trigger serious injury.

An expert garage door service technician can check the moving parts and recognize the source of the sound. Resolving the issue early may likewise assist prevent damage to other elements.

  1. The Door Opens or Closes Unevenly

A properly operating garage door need to move smoothly and stay relatively level as it travels along its tracks. If one side of the door increases faster than the other or the door appears misaligned during operation, there could be an issue with the balance or alignment of the system.

You may see that a person side sits greater than the other when the door is open. The bottom of the door may also fail to meet the ground evenly when it closes. Sometimes, the door may shake, drag or appear to move at an angle.

Several parts might contribute to this issue, consisting of springs, cable televisions, rollers or tracks. Continuing to run an uneven door can put extra pressure on the automatic opener and other mechanical components.

  1. Your Garage Door Is Slow or Struggles to Move

Another typical warning indication is a garage door that has ended up being noticeably slower than it used to be. If your door takes significantly longer to open or close, is reluctant before moving or appears to have a hard time during operation, it needs to be checked.

A slow garage door can have a number of possible causes. The tracks might require attention, the rollers might be worn, the springs might be losing their efficiency or the automatic opener may be experiencing a problem.

Take note of changes in how the door sounds and moves. If the motor seems to be working harder than usual or the door stops and starts throughout operation, continuing to use it without identifying the cause might lead to further wear.

Your garage door opener is created to run an effectively well balanced door. When the door becomes heavier or more hard to move, the opener might require to work harder to raise it.

  1. The Garage Door Does Not Stay Open

If your garage door starts closing after you have actually totally opened it, this is a severe indication. An effectively functioning door needs to have the ability to remain open without all of a sudden dropping or slowly moving towards the ground.

The garage door spring system plays an important function in reversing the weight of the door. When springs become used or damaged, the door can become much heavier and more challenging to manage.

You may discover that the door feels uncommonly heavy when operated by hand or that it starts to drop after reaching the open position.

A malfunctioning spring can also put additional strain on the garage door opener. In some scenarios, continued usage can lead to further damage to the door or opener.

  1. Your Garage Door Keeps Getting Stuck

A garage door that consistently gets stuck is another clear indication that something is wrong. The door may stop halfway, refuse to open totally or become stuck at a specific point during its movement.

In other cases, the door may act inconsistently and stop at various positions.

Potential causes can include damaged tracks, worn rollers, cable issues, spring problems, blockages or faults with the automated opener. For automatic garage doors, issues with the security sensors can also impact the door's capability to close.

Before arranging a repair, you can check whether there is an apparent item blocking the door's path. You can also ensure the location around the security sensors is clear.

If there is no obvious obstruction and the problem continues, professional assessment is advised.

  1. You Notification Visible Damage or Used Components

Some garage door issues can be recognized through an easy visual evaluation. You may notice a damaged cable, bent track, cracked roller, rusted element, loose bracket or harmed door panel.

Visible damage ought to not be disregarded, especially if it impacts a component accountable for supporting or controlling the movement of the door.

A torn cable television can end up being more harmed over time and may ultimately break. A bent track can impact how efficiently the rollers move, while harmed rollers can increase friction and noise.

Perth's environment can also contribute to deterioration. Strong UV direct exposure can affect certain materials and finishes, while moisture and salted air may contribute to corrosion, especially for residential or commercial properties situated better to the coast.

If you notice a part that looks damaged, avoid attempting to align, get rid of or repair it yourself. An expert specialist can identify whether the element can be fixed or needs to be replaced.

  1. Your Garage Door Reverses or Behaves Unpredictably

Modern automated garage doors consist of safety functions developed to reduce the threat of accidents. If your door suddenly reverses, declines to close effectively or acts in a different way from regular, it ought to be examined.

The door might start closing and then instantly reverse. It may stop before reaching the ground, operate intermittently or fail to react regularly to the remote.

Safety sensors can sometimes be accountable for uncommon behaviour. If sensors end up being unclean, misaligned or obstructed, the door might identify an evident obstruction and reverse.

Nevertheless, unpredictable operation can also be triggered by issues with the opener, circuitry, push-button controls or mechanical elements.

When Should You Call a Garage Door Expert?

Understanding when to arrange a repair work can assist avoid a small problem from ending up being a major failure.

If your garage door has actually unexpectedly become loud, sluggish, unequal or challenging to run, it is worth having it assessed. The same uses if you notice visible damage, a broken spring, a harmed cable television or a door that consistently gets stuck.

Problems involving springs, cable televisions, tracks and other mechanical parts ought to normally be managed by a trained expert. These parts can support considerable weight and, sometimes, stay under considerable stress even when the door is not moving.

Professional repair work can also help identify the origin of the problem rather than simply resolving the symptom.

For instance, replacing a worn roller might fix excessive sound, however if the roller has been wearing too soon because the track is misaligned, the underlying problem also requires to be resolved.

Can You Fix a Garage Door Yourself?

There are some simple garage door maintenance tasks that house owners can perform, such as keeping the area around the door clear and looking for apparent obstructions.

More complicated repairs must be left to a qualified garage door professional.
